RE: Is this a Bargain?

Sibley

The price looks very good to me.
There are a couple of cylinders missing but that isn`t really important as everyone has their own preferences.

The most important question is -Is it properly registered?
On the logbook it must say cobra replica, Pilgrim, Sumo or something similar.
If it says Ford, Jaguar or anything like that then you WILL have problems with future MOT`s etc and you WILL have to go through SVA.

If it is registered correctly and you can get affordable insurance then go for it.
